WebSep 21, 2024 · In this activity students will be sorting, counting, tasting and graphing apples. Start with a variety of apples (red, yellow, green). Make sure to have enough for each student to taste. Create a class graph based on the apple varieties. Students will taste each variety of apple and then choose their favorite. WebChildren roll out the play dough, flat like a pancake and press leaves into the play dough. When the leaves are removed, they see the imprint of the leaf with the veins. This works best when you press the back side of the leaf into the play dough. The same activity can be done using clay. Press the leaves into a flattened piece of clay and ...
